MEDINA, Ohio, Aug. 3, 2011 /PRNewswire/ — RPM International Inc. (NYSE: RPM) announced today that its Performance Coatings Group has acquired API S.p.A., a $28 million producer and installer of polyurethane and urethane-based flooring and decking solutions for cruise ships, mega-yachts and naval applications. Based in Genoa, Italy, API also produces epoxy and polyurethane flooring systems for the Italian building market.

API will continue to be led by Giorgio Magnaghi, managing director and grandson of company founder Mario Magnaghi, along with his management team, which includes Vittorio and Beniamino Magnaghi, also grandsons of the founder. The acquisition is expected to be accretive to earnings within one year, and terms were not disclosed.

“API enhances RPM’s presence in the decorative flooring market and will complement the strengths of our Stonhard and Flowcrete commercial polymer flooring businesses,” stated Frank C. Sullivan, RPM chairman and chief executive officer. “We’re fortunate to have Giorgio Magnaghi and his team continue to run this business as part of RPM, and their joining with us is yet another example of RPM’s appeal as an ideal home for entrepreneurs in our industry.”

About RPM

RPM International Inc., a holding company, owns subsidiaries that are world leaders in specialty coatings, sealants, building materials and related services serving both industrial and consumer markets. RPM’s industrial products include roofing systems, sealants, corrosion control coatings, flooring coatings and specialty chemicals. Industrial brands include Stonhard, Tremco, illbruck, Carboline, Euco, Flowcrete and Universal Sealants. RPM’s consumer products are used by professionals and do-it-yourselfers for home maintenance and improvement and by hobbyists. Consumer brands include Zinsser, Rust-Oleum, DAP, Varathane and Testors.
